Geneva College Chemistry Society


Faculty Advisors: Dr. Rodney Austin and Dr. Kerry McMahon

The Chemistry Society is a student affiliate chapter of the American Chemical Society (ACS). The chapter has been recognized as an honorable mention by the ACS for the quality of professional and service activities in 2005-06 and again in 2014-15.

Geneva has a student-led organization that exists to provide social and academic opportunities for Chemistry and other Science Majors. Over the past several years the Chemistry Society has planned the following events:

  • Movie Nights
  • Special Speakers
  • Visits to local schools to present science lessons
  • Fieldtrips to local industries
  • Liquid nitrogen ice cream
  • Big Kablooey
  • National Chemistry Week Activities
  • Pumpkin explosions
